What’s Driving AV Gear In 2026: Key Trends And Why They Matter
The latest gear and av techoelite centers on networked audio and video. Teams move signals over IP to cut cable runs and speed deployment. Manufacturers add native support for ST 2110 and Dante to reduce latency. Buyers want systems that work with cloud services for remote control and monitoring. They prefer equipment that accepts firmware updates over the network. Power efficiency now factors into purchase decisions. Vendors push low-power amplifiers and LED displays that draw less energy. Users demand built-in AI features for auto framing, auto-mixing, and voice enhancement. These features lower staffing needs and raise production quality. The market favors modular devices that accept swappable cards or software licenses. This approach lets teams expand capabilities without replacing racks. The latest gear and av techoelite also emphasizes user interfaces. Touch panels and web dashboards must stay simple. Installers choose devices with clear APIs to speed integration. Security now appears in vendor roadmaps. Teams prefer gear with role-based access and encrypted control channels. The trend list shows why buyers pick certain products. It connects product claims to real operational gains. When readers evaluate options, they should match trend features to use cases. Top Hardware Picks Right Now: Cameras, Mixers, Displays And Audio
The latest gear and av techoelite includes compact PTZ cameras with 4K sensors and NDI output. Brands now add built-in edge processing for background replacement and low-bandwidth streaming. They sell camera models that accept remote firmware updates and simple presets. Mixers now ship with multitrack USB and AES67 support. Installers pick mixers that offer local analog paths plus networked returns. They choose boards with clear meters and tactile controls for live shows. Displays favor direct-view LED for medium rooms and mini-LED LCD for boardrooms. Buyers pick displays with auto-calibration and integrated color management. For audio, line-array speakers and column arrays get lighter cabinet designs and DSP on board. Amplifiers move toward Class D designs that trade little heat for high output. Wireless mic systems now include multichannel encryption and spectrum scanning. Producers look for systems that reserve channels automatically. Pro vs Consumer: What To Compare When Choosing AV Gear
Professionals choose durability and serviceability over low price. They expect 5+ year lifecycles and clear RMA paths. Consumers favor lower cost and plug-and-play simplicity. The latest gear and av techoelite reveals these differences in warranties, support, and firmware policy. Pro devices offer redundant power and hot-swappable parts. Consumer models often use sealed designs that limit repair. Pro audio gear lists detailed spec sheets for THD, SNR, and latency. Consumer gear shows simpler specs like watts and channels. When teams compare, they should list core needs first. They should ask how often staff will operate the system. If users change settings daily, choose hardware with a simple control surface. If integrators handle settings, choose devices with rich API options. The latest gear and av techoelite calls for evaluating total cost of ownership. That cost includes service contracts, spare parts, and training. Buyers should compare voice-quality samples, camera low-light footage, and display uniformity reports. They should test failover scenarios to confirm reliability.
Planning, Integration And Future‑Proofing: How To Choose AV Tech For Your Space
Teams plan by mapping use cases to room workflows. They list signal paths, control points, and user touchpoints. Then they match devices that fit those paths. The latest gear and av techoelite calls for simple network layouts that separate AV traffic from general data. Integrators set VLANs and QoS to protect streams. They choose switches with PoE and SFP ports for flexible links. Future-proofing starts with modular choices. Select devices that accept firmware upgrades and optional licenses. Buy extra channels on mixers or leave rack space for expansion. The latest gear and av techoelite guides decisions on cabling. Use single-mode fiber for long runs and shielded copper for short runs. Label each cable and document terminations. Integration uses a central control engine that runs scenes and health checks. Teams script automated recovery steps to cut downtime. They log events and push alerts to phone apps. For budgets, plan phased rollouts. Ship a core system first, then add features in later phases. The latest gear and av techoelite rewards this staged approach with lower risk and clear milestones. Installers train end users with short, focused sessions. They create one-page quick guides that cover daily tasks. Finally, teams schedule quarterly reviews to check firmware, spare parts, and configuration backups.
